Neighborhoods

Fishing port and yacht marina with a nearby Castle and wonderful walks around the headland. Great eateries from humble fish and chips to fine dining. Lots of pubs with good atmosphere. Try the Harbour Bar at 4pm on a Sunday afternoon. Frequented mostly by locals and slightly off the usual tourist trail. Fantastic walks along the East pier out to the lighthouse with views to Ireland's Eye island. The West pier hosts a number of fish restaurants and some playful seals in the harbour.

Malahide Castle park with large playground and lovely walks through the gardens. Great cafes and restaurants in Malahide village. Seafront walk through to Portmarnock.

Fantastic day out especially for families as there is a farm with animals to view and learn about. Beautiful walks through the woods. Accessible from Donabate train station only one stop from Malahide on the Drogheda line.
